Brief summary
RATIONALE: Stereotactic radiosurgery may be able to send x-rays directly to the tumor and cause less damage to normal tissue. PURPOSE: This phase I trial is studying the side effects of stereotactic radiosurgery in treating patients with locally advanced or recurrent head and neck cancer.
Detailed description
OBJECTIVES: * To determine the feasibility and tolerability of CyberKnife® stereotactic radiosurgery as boost therapy after standard chemoradiotherapy in patients with locally advanced head and neck cancer. * To determine the feasibility and tolerability of CyberKnife® stereotactic radiosurgery as salvage therapy in patients with locally recurrent head and neck cancer. OUTLINE: Patients are assigned to 1 of 2 treatment groups according to disease status after prior standard therapy. Patients with residual disease after standard therapy are assigned to group 1. Patients with recurrent disease ≥ 6 months after standard therapy are assigned to group 2. All patients undergo placement of 3-6 gold fiducial markers within 1-2 weeks of beginning CyberKnife® stereotactic radiosurgery (SRS) treatment. * Group 1 (CyberKnife® SRS boost therapy): Patients undergo CyberKnife® SRS boost therapy (2 fractionated doses) beginning 4-8 weeks after completion of standard therapy. * Group 2 (CyberKnife® SRS salvage therapy): Patients undergo CyberKnife® SRS salvage therapy (5 fractions) 3 times weekly. After completion of study treatment, patients are followed periodically for up to 2 years.

Eligibility
Inclusion criteria
DISEASE CHARACTERISTICS: * Biopsy-confirmed\* invasive head and neck cancer, including the following primary sites: * Nasopharynx * Oropharynx * Paranasal sinus * Oral cavity * Orbit * Salivary gland NOTE: \*Biopsy must be performed prior to initiation of external beam radiotherapy (EBRT) * Stage T2-4 tumor at the time of diagnosis * Primary tumor ≤ 5 cm in diameter at the time of CyberKnife® stereotactic radiosurgery (SRS) * Meets one of the following criteria: * Eligible for CyberKnife® SRS as boost therapy, as defined by one of the following criteria: * Planning to undergo definitive EBRT, with or without chemotherapy, with curative intent for primary head and neck cancer * Biopsy-confirmed locally persistent disease \< 3 months after completion of definitive EBRT * Eligible for CyberKnife® SRS as salvage therapy\*, as defined by one of the following criteria: * Biopsy-confirmed locally recurrent disease occurring ≥ 6 months after the completion of radiotherapy; achieved a complete response to initial therapy by imaging or clinical examination; had \> 50% of the tumor volume in the prior irradiated volume; and received \> 45 Gy of radiotherapy * Biopsy-confirmed locally recurrent disease occurring between 6 weeks and 6 months after the completion of radiotherapy; achieved a complete response to initial therapy by imaging or clinical examination; had \< 50% of the tumor volume in the prior irradiated volume; and received \> 45 Gy of radiotherapy NOTE: \*Not a candidate for salvage surgery or brachytherapy * Anticipated total dose of radiotherapy to the spinal cord ≤ 50 Gy (including prior dose) PATIENT CHARACTERISTICS: * Karnofsky performance status 60-100% * Not pregnant or nursing * Fertile patients must use effective contraception * Able to achieve normal tissue tolerance to critical structures with the CyberKnife® planning system * Able to undergo CT simulation PRIOR CONCURRENT THERAPY: * See Disease Characteristics
Exclusion criteria
* No laryngeal or hypopharyngeal cancer * No evidence of distant metastases * No prior brachytherapy * No prior CyberKnife® SRS boost or salvage therapy * No other malignancy within the past 5 years except basal cell or squamous cell skin cancer or carcinoma in situ of the cervix * No active connective tissue disorders (e.g., lupus or scleroderma)

Outcome results
Duration of Local Control
Median time to local failure based on regional or distant metastatic disease
Time frame: 1 year
Population: Boost subjects were not evaluable.
| Arm | Measure | Value (MEDIAN) | Dispersion |
|---|---|---|---|
| Group 2 (CK SRS Salvage Therapy) | Duration of Local Control | 4.6 number of months to local failure | Standard Deviation 1.6 |
